With the delay now for AEFS, that goal from the TFDM program office is in jeopardy of being realized. A meeting is scheduled for 6/16 with NASA to discuss options in case AEFS cann ot be brought up to a level of stability needed to interface with the NASA components. SWIM Visualization Tool (SVT) o There will be a Configuration Control Board (CCB) meeting the week of 6/13 to discuss the future of SVT , what improvements should be made, where else to install the program, etc.
